Current Ecological Changes
The global focus on sustainability has intensified, with numerous countries adopting stricter policies targeting lowering CO2 emissions and promoting renewable energy sources. Governments are enforcing measures to incentivize businesses and individuals to invest in eco-friendly technologies, which has led to a rise in innovations in solar and wind energy. As a result, the shift towards greener energy is not only seen as environmentally beneficial but also as a vital step towards economic stability in the face of climate change.
A different significant movement is the increasing recognition and efforts surrounding plastic pollution. Cities and countries are implementing prohibitions on disposable plastics and promoting the creation of biodegradable alternatives. Initiatives such as beach cleanups and local recycling initiatives are gaining traction, fostering a shared sense of responsibility. Online platforms campaigns are also playing a vital role in raising awareness about the impacts of plastic waste on marine life and natural habitats, prompting increasing numbers of individuals to reduce their plastic consumption.
The clothing industry is also experiencing a shift towards sustainable practices, with companies adopting eco-friendly materials and ethical production methods. Fast fashion’s environmental effects is prompting consumers to seek out more eco-conscious options, leading to a rise in thrift shopping and clothing rental services. As buyers become more informed about the consequences of their buying decisions, companies are increasingly held accountable for their environmental footprint, thus driving a substantial transformation in industry standards.
Significant Concerns Confronting the Planet
Climate change remains one of the most pressing problems currently troubling the planet. Rising global temperatures have caused intense weather events, such as tropical cyclones, droughts, and deluges, which disrupt natural systems and threaten human well-being. The increased occurrence and intensity of these events call for urgent action to reduce greenhouse gas emissions and shift to sustainable energy options. Countries around the world are struggling with the need to harmonize economic development with environmental responsibility, making collaboration essential for successful strategies.
A further critical issue is the decline of biodiversity, which is taking place at an unsettling rate due to habitat destruction, pollution, and global warming. Natural habitats are experiencing their equilibrium as species face extinction, interrupting food webs and reducing resilience against environmental changes. The interconnectedness of species highlights the necessity for conservation efforts that safeguard natural areas and advocate for eco-friendly practices. Pollution poses a major threat to both the environment and public health. Air and water quality are worsening due to manufacturing activities, plastic waste, and fertilizer runoff. This pollution has extensive consequences, impacting animal populations, ecosystems, and human communities. Efforts to reduce the use of plastics, enforce tougher emissions standards, and advocate for cleaner technologies are vital in mitigating these issues. Raising awareness and cultivating community engagement can enable individuals and organizations to play a role in cleaner, healthier environments.
### Innovative Approaches for the Tomorrow
As we humanity struggles with rising ecological crises, new solutions are emerging which offer hope in achieving an sustainable way forward. One such advancement is creating biodegradable substitutes to plastic materials, that harm our seas and waste sites . Organizations are now creating materials made from renewable resources such as corn starch and seaweed , designed to disintegrate efficiently while lessen our dependence on conventional plastic products. These innovations not only mitigate waste and also promote a transition to greater eco-friendly creation methods .
Another promising strategy is the emergence of urban agriculture , which utilizes limited areas within urban regions to grow produce in a sustainable way. By incorporating advanced technologies such as water-based growing systems and air-based growing techniques , these farms can yield high yields while using markedly less irrigation along with without requiring pesticides . This approach not only assists in lowering greenhouse gas emissions caused by transporting food from far away and also promotes local agricultural practices within cities , thus making locally sourced produce readily available for people living in cities .
In conclusion, progress in sustainable energy technologies are at the forefront in the movement towards an more sustainable environment. Solar and wind generation are increasingly becoming more effective as well as affordable, enabling greater utilization across various sectors . New developments like floating solar farms as well as marine wind energy systems utilize previously unused natural resources while lessening the requirement for land. As these these advancements improve , they aim to additionally diminish our need for oil and gas, paving the way in the direction of a healthier and more sustainable energy environment.
